Jump to content

JsonT HTML stopper


ohdang888

Recommended Posts

So i'm learning JSON Transformation....learned about it here:http://goessner.net/articles/jsont/

 

 

this is my code with it:

<script type="text/javascript">
var HTMLrule = "{data.actor}'s final GPA is {data.gpa.s2}. \n  <img src='{data.images.src}' /> ";

var data = { "data": {"actor":"Tommy", "gpa": {"s1":"4.0", "s2":"3.9"}, "images":{"src": "http://www.google.com/intl/en_ALL/images/logo.gif", "href":"http://www.google.com/"} }};
var rule = { "data": HTMLrule };
function test(){
   show(jsonT(data, rule));
}
function show(s) { document.getElementById("out").innerHTML += (s+"\n").replace(/&/g, "&").replace(/</g,"<").replace(/>/g,">").replace(/\n/g, "<br/>") + "<hr/>"; }
window.onload = test;
</script>

 

it works, except for the HTML part. It simply shows the HTML, and doesn't show the image.

 

Any way around this?

(also, i tried using > and <, but that doesn't work either)

Link to comment
https://forums.phpfreaks.com/topic/161830-jsont-html-stopper/
Share on other sites

Archived

This topic is now archived and is closed to further replies.

×
×
  • Create New...

Important Information

We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ue.